Of An Age at Deckchair Cinema

Of An Age

MON 1 MAY

Coming Soon to
Deckchair Cinema

100 mins | Rated MA15+ (Strong coarse language)


Summer 1999. In blue-collar North Melbourne, 17-year-old Serbian immigrant Kol is out of school forever. He’s preparing for the Australian Dance finals when he receives a distress call from his dance partner, Ebony, who has woken up on an unfamiliar beach after a big night out. With the help of Ebony’s older brother, Adam, they attempt to make it to the finals on time but when Kol and Adam get stuck in summer traffic, they begin to realise they have more in common than they first thought. Over the course of the next 24 hours, an unexpected and intense romance blossoms. A decade later the pair meet for a bittersweet reunion.
